How often do I need to mow my lawn?
Weekly is the standard for most lawn mowing services in St. Louis, particularly those on a fertilization program and receiving regular watering from irrigation during extended periods of dry weather. Lawns without regular fertilization or irrigation can typically go biweekly during the slower stretches of summer. Do you bag grass clippings or leave them on the lawn?
Grass clipping management depends on the lawn and the conditions. Clippings are mulched back into the turf when conditions are right, which returns nutrients to the soil. When clippings are too long or wet to mulch cleanly, they get cleared.
